[Asia Economy Reporter Oh Hyung-gil] By 6 p.m. on the weekend of the 12th, the number of confirmed COVID-19 cases exceeded 50,000.


According to the quarantine authorities, Seoul city, and other local governments, from midnight to 6 p.m. on that day, 48,025 people nationwide across 17 cities and provinces were confirmed positive for COVID-19.


This is 4,510 more than the previous highest count for the same time period, recorded on the 10th with 43,515 cases.


It is also 5,087 more than the count of 42,938 cases recorded by 6 p.m. the previous day, and about 2.3 times the 21,338 cases reported a week earlier on the 5th. Compared to two weeks ago on the 29th of last month (10,665 cases), it is approximately 4.5 times higher.


Since there is still time until midnight when the count is finalized, the number of new confirmed cases to be announced on the 13th is expected to increase further.



Following the impact of the Lunar New Year holiday, a large number of cases have continued throughout this week. The quarantine authorities estimate that daily new confirmed cases could reach between 130,000 and 170,000 by the end of this month, while the National Institute for Mathematical Sciences projects that the daily maximum could reach up to 360,000 cases in early next month.
